As You Go Through Life by Ella Wheeler Wilcox













Don't look for the flaws as you go through life;    And even when you find them, It is wise and kind to be somewhat blind    And look for the virtue behind them. For the cloudiest night has a hint of light    Somewhere in its shadows hiding; It is better by far to hunt for a star,    Than the spots on the sun abiding. The current of life runs ever away    To the bosom of God's great ocean. Don't set your force 'gainst the river's course    And think to alter its motion. Don't waste a curse on the universe--    Remember it lived before you. Don't butt at the storm with your puny form,    But bend and let it go o'er you. The world will never adjust itself    To suit your whims to the letter. Some things must go wrong your whole life long,    And the sooner you know it the better.
